GULF INS. CO. v. BOBO

No. B-8571.

595 S.W.2d 847 (1980)

GULF INSURANCE COMPANY, Petitioner, v. Mrs. Minnie O. BOBO et al., Respondents.

Supreme Court of Texas.

Rehearing Denied April 16, 1980.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Simon, Peebles, Haskell, Gardner & Betty, Anne Gardner, Fort Worth, for petitioner.

Hudson, Keltner, Smith, Cunningham & Payne, Joe Bruce Cunningham, J. M. Lee, Fort Worth, for respondents.


SPEARS, Justice.

Minnie Bobo and Mary Lambert brought suit to recover the amount of a default judgment against David L. Havens as an additional insured under a liability insurance policy issued by Gulf Insurance Company to William C. Avett.
